If you follow the tutorial on configure replicas set tag sets, the examples refer you to read preferences for implementation of using tags with read preferences. However, this page then makes a circular reference back to the tags tutorial (above). There are no cited examples on either of those pages of using tags (as a string) to read preference options. In addition, the connection string docs do appear to have an example, however the example given appears to violate the spec for the URI. For example, if multiple tags are specified of the same type, the last value is usually taken, which is exactly what is cited for multiple values. |
